WebIf shareholders’ equity is positive, that indicates the company has enough assets to cover its liabilities. But in the case that it’s negative, that means its debt and debt-like obligations outnumber its assets. WebNegative equity is usually bad, but when companies have big buybacks, their Treasury Stock can make total shareholders' equity go negative. And this is fine. ... you have limited liability as a shareholder, so nobody is going to come and knock your door to collect their debt or ruin your credit rating. But it would mean you lost your investment ...

Web8 de ago. de 2024 · This is typically called a shareholder loan “credit balance” or due to shareholder. An example of a shareholder loan account ledger showing a “credit balance” could look like this. The negative $7,500 balance on August 11th shows that the company now owes the shareholder $7,500.
